MCPP.jpgMasterCard will launch a new 30-second TVC this Sunday (31 March) for its contactless payment technology, PayPass via McCann Australia.

The campaign is based on the insight that no matter how vigilant a parent is, kids will be kids, especially when out and about shopping. The wise parent needs an exit strategy for these times – enter MasterCard PayPass.

MCPP2.jpgSays John Mescall, executive creative director of McCann Australia said: “What happens when you take a young kid with a sword, an old bloke with an eye-patch, and a mum with a MasterCard and put them all together in the same ad? This.”

The campaign includes retail out-of-home executions as well as a usage promotion developed by MercerBell.

Abe Forsyth of Jungleboys returns as director, following his direction of the MasterCard PayPass spot ‘Chocolate Dash’ which launched in September last year.
